Reconstruction:Proto-West Germanic/brust
Proto-West Germanic
Etymology
From Proto-Germanic *brusts.
Noun
*brust f
- breast, chest
Inflection
Consonant stem | ||
---|---|---|
Singular | Plural | |
Nominative | *brust | *brusti |
Accusative | *brustu | *brusti |
Genitive | *brusti | *brustō |
Dative | *brusti | *brustum |
Instrumental | *brusti | *brustum |
